The Indian Space Research Organisation (ISRO) is set to revolutionize lunar exploration with the launch of Chandrayaan 4. This upcoming mission aims to delve deeper into the Moon’s unexplored territories, bringing new possibilities for scientific discovery and technological advancement. While its predecessors primarily focused on mapping and surface exploration, Chandrayaan 4 will deploy cutting-edge technologies to conduct comprehensive studies beneath the lunar crust.

Advancing Lunar Research: Unlike previous missions, Chandrayaan 4 will employ advanced seismographic instruments to study moonquakes and develop a high-resolution subsurface profile. This innovative approach could unlock the secrets of the Moon’s geological past, providing critical data that can inform future lunar habitation efforts.

Power of AI and Robotics: Chandrayaan 4 will also be a showcase of India’s prowess in artificial intelligence and robotics. Equipped with AI-driven autonomous robots, the mission will carry out complex experiments without direct human intervention. These robots will be capable of traversing and analyzing hazardous terrains, capturing high-definition images, and sending real-time data back to Earth.

Implications for the Future: The success of Chandrayaan 4 could usher in a new era of space exploration. It paves the way for future manned missions, lunar mining operations, and could even act as a launchpad for deep space explorations. With this mission, ISRO not only aims to enhance its scientific repertoire but also inspire collaboration across global space agencies.

As we stand on the verge of this groundbreaking mission, Chandrayaan 4 promises to be a giant leap for lunar exploration, potentially unlocking doors to mysteries long concealed beneath the Moon’s surface.
